Flash will not work

Flash will not work on my MacBook Pro. It works on my wife's MacBook Air and on her iPad and our phones, but anything that requires Flash on my MacBook Pro generates a dialogue box saying I need to download the latest version of Flash. I've downloaded and installed Flash to no avail; then I uninstalled it and reinstalled it. In the Flash System Settings, Advanced Settings. I've "Deleted All" Browsing Data & Settings but Flash still won't work on this computer. HELP!

MacBook Pro (Retina, 15-inch, Early 2013)

Download and install Flash directly from Adobe to make sure you are getting the latest version. Once it installs, it should open to an Adobe page confirming you installed it properly.


If it doesn't work properly, open Safari > Prefences > Security > Check "Allow Plug-ins"

If it is already checked, click on "Plug-in Settings" then make sure Flash is checked
